Quality Control (QC) Data Review Now Available
The Office of Assessment and Accountability (OAA) opened the Student Data Review and Rosters (SDRR) application for a review of individual student data for ACCESS, Alternate ACCESS, Kentucky Summative Assessment (KSA), Alternate Kentucky Summative Assessment (AKSA), the Four-Year (2025) and Five-Year (2024) Cohort Graduation Rate, Postsecondary Readiness (PR), and PR Scores. The data review process provides schools and districts the opportunity to verify which students were tested and reportable for ACCESS/Alternate ACCESS, KSA, AKSA, and PR, determine nonparticipations, assess students meeting or not meeting the academic benchmarks for Postsecondary Readiness, and mark accommodations for students with an Individualized Education Plan (IEP) or classified as English Learners (EL) before public reporting.
All tickets must be submitted by 5 p.m. ET, Thursday, Aug. 21. This data review period is the last opportunity to request changes to individual student-level data prior to Public Release. (Districts will get one more look at the data on QC Day; however, only systemic issues can be reported at that time.) OAA acknowledges that August is a hectic time for district staff with the reopening of schools. Early submission of changes allows ample time to resolve any problems a school or district might experience before the data review closes.
During the SDRR Data Review Process, districts will be able to complete the following:
- Scan and upload Medical Nonparticipation forms in SDRR for one or more content areas for KSA and AKSA.
- Submit nonparticipations for:
- First year EL,
- Student Expelled without Services,
- Initially Fully English Proficient (IFEP),
- Redesignated Fully English Proficient (RFEP) and
- Roster Clean-up if needed. The Roster Clean-up nonparticipation addresses situations where the student appears on the student listing in error. Districts must explain why the student was not deleted from the Spring roster, or why the student appears on the student listing in error in the text box when the nonparticipation is selected. OAA will approve Roster Clean-up tickets, provided Infinite Campus (IC) also reflects the information.
- Request approval for demographic changes to the student data such as IEP, EL, and lunch status, etc. in SDRR, which will be approved by OAA, provided Infinite Campus (IC) also reflects the information (as of the first day of the 14-day spring summative testing for the district).
- Mark “Yes” or “No” under the accommodations column even if there is a “Yes” or “No” in the IEP column, if a student had an accommodation during testing for the assessments, not reflected in SDRR.

Nondisclosures
Schools and districts should not share the preliminary data beyond the leadership level during the QC process. Please remember, all the data must be kept secure until public reporting. The data cannot be shared publicly or through email. Anyone reviewing the data will need to fill out the Nondisclosure Form, and District Assessment Coordinators (DACs) should keep the forms on file in the district office.
